Key Outputs

  • Ensure compliance with health, safety and consumer protection regulations
  • Greet customers and provide a friendly, helpful in-store experience
  • Maintain visual merchandising standards on the sales floor
  • Operate point-of-sale systems and process payments accurately
  • Train new team members on store procedures and product knowledge

Candidate Profile

  • Minimum of 1-2 years’ experience in a customer-facing retail role
  • Willingness to work public holidays and end-of-month peaks
  • Visual merchandising flair or formal training is an advantage
  • Honest, dependable and security-aware in line with shrinkage controls
  • Matric / National Senior Certificate (Grade 12)
  • Experience with stock counting and basic inventory principles
